Here's the assumption that trips up almost everyone shopping for this stuff: a Wi-Fi icon that says connected means the feeder is going to do its job on schedule. It doesn't work that way. Connection status only confirms the radio found a network — it says nothing about whether the schedule stored inside the unit is the one actually firing, or whether a five-second drop during the exact minute of a scheduled meal just got quietly skipped. The 'Connected' Icon Is Lying to You

My neighbor two floors up, Caulfield Rios, borrowed a spare feeder from me for a long weekend when his restaurant shifts pushed feeding time to five in the morning, earlier than he could manage himself. He plugged it in, opened the app, and got stuck for twenty minutes assuming the unit was defective. It wasn't. His phone had defaulted to the apartment's 5GHz network during setup, and the feeder's radio only speaks 2.4GHz, so from the feeder's side, there was nothing broadcasting to join at all.

Your Feeder Isn't Behind the Times for Using 2.4GHz

Not even close. It's true 5GHz is the newer, faster standard your phone defaults to, but smart home hardware — feeders, plugs, most cameras — leans on 2.4GHz on purpose, because the lower frequency pushes through walls, cabinets, and a fridge between the router and the kitchen far better than 5GHz manages. A feeder locked to that band isn't cutting corners. It's using the range built for exactly this job.

Walls, Microwaves, and the Reconnect Gap

Look, Wi-Fi interference in a kitchen isn't abstract. A microwave running while a scheduled meal is due sits right on the 2.4GHz spectrum and can knock a weaker feeder's connection out entirely for the length of the cook cycle. That's the part most product pages skip over: it's not just about how far you are from the router, it's about what else in the kitchen is fighting for the same slice of spectrum at the same time.

Deena Portsmith, a former coworker of mine who now freelances the way I do, sat through one of my app teardowns and flagged something I'd glossed over: neither app actually tells you whether a reconnect after a drop caught up on a missed dispense or just silently skipped it. The interface treats both outcomes the same, a green dot and a timestamp, which is exactly the kind of shortcut that makes connected feel like more of a guarantee than it is.

Bowls, Freshness, and the Stuff Wi-Fi Doesn't Touch

None of this touches the bowl itself, which turned out to matter more than expected. Plastic scratches into microscopic grooves that trap bacteria, and it's the reason a lot of owners see chin breakouts they end up blaming on food instead. Both feeders I've tested long-term switched me over to 304 stainless bowls, and popping the lid back into place after a wash is its own small ritual — the silicone gasket resists at first, cold under my thumb, before it seats with a soft give that tells me the seal actually caught.

Check These Before You Blame the Router

A stable connection also won't save you from problems that have nothing to do with signal strength. A cat determined enough to pry a lid open by force needs a feeder built to resist that, not a better router. Two cats eating different amounts on different schedules turns portion separation into its own layer of complexity, usually solved with a microchip collar rather than anything Wi-Fi related. Wet food left out too long spoils regardless of how many bars your connection shows, and Denver's hard water will clog a fountain filter faster than any firmware update fixes.

Battery backup only buys borrowed time during an actual outage, and how much time varies enough between models that it deserves its own look. The bigger question underneath that is whether a feeder still fires from a schedule it cached on its own chip after a router goes down mid-cycle, or just stalls the second the connection drops — that's the real one, and I dug into it in the redundancy rule for offline feeders.

So don't just glance at the signal bars before you buy. Check whether the manufacturer states outright that the schedule lives on the feeder itself, confirm it's explicitly a 2.4GHz device rather than an auto-band gamble, and look for any mention of what happens after a router reboot. That's the real reliability question, not whichever icon your app happens to be showing right now.
